How does Rainscales de-risk deployment?

Through a structured POC that establishes baseline metrics, defines success criteria, and quantifies business impact before scale decisions.

What does human-verified agentic process automation mean?

AI-driven workflows that take next-step actions, with human oversight on accuracy-sensitive steps to keep operators in control.
